Membuat aplikasi pengaduan masyarakat part I

 Assalamualaikum Wr. Wb.

Ahmad Dindan Romadhoni


    Aplikasi Aplikasi Pengaduan Masyarakat adalah aplikasi pengelolaan dan tindak lanjut pengaduan serta pelaporan hasil pengelolaan pengaduan yang disediakan oleh Kementerian Komunikasi dan Informatika sebagai salah satu sarana bagi setiap pejabat/pegawai Kementerian Komunikasi dan Informatika sebagai pihak internal maupun masyarakat luas pengguna layanan Kementerian Komunikasi dan Informatika sebagai pihak eksternal untuk melaporkan dugaan adanya pelanggaran yang dilakukan/diberikan oleh pejabat/pegawai Kementerian Komunikasi dan Informatika

Langkah Pertama yang harus dilakukan adalah membuat database dengan nama database ukk yanng berisikan 4 tabel yaitu 'masyarakat' , 'pengaduan' , 'petugas', dan 'tanggapan' . kemudian kita membuat login untuk petugas,admin,dan masyarakat

langkah pertama kita membuat file login.php untuk login admin dan petugas

login.php




style.css


body{

font-family: sans-serif;

background: #ebf9fb;

}


h1{

text-align: center;

/*ketebalan font*/

font-weight: 300;

}


.tulisan_login{

text-align: center;

/*membuat semua huruf menjadi kapital*/

text-transform: uppercase;

}

.kotak_login{

width: 350px;

background: white;

/*meletakkan form ke tengah*/

margin: 80px auto;

padding: 30px 20px;

box-shadow: 0px 0px 100px 4px #d6d6d6;

}

label{

font-size: 11pt;

}

.form_login{

/*membuat lebar form penuh*/

box-sizing : border-box;

width: 100%;

padding: 10px;

font-size: 11pt;

margin-bottom: 20px;

}

.tombol_login{

background: #2aa7e2;

color: white;

font-size: 11pt;

width: 100%;

border: none;

border-radius: 3px;

padding: 10px 20px;

}


.link{

color: #232323;

text-decoration: none;

font-size: 10pt;

}

.alert{

background: #e44e4e;

color: white;

padding: 10px;

text-align: center;

border:1px solid #b32929;

}


Hasilnya adalah:


cek_login.php





 setelah itu kita membuat koneksi

koneksi.php

<?php 

$koneksi = mysqli_connect("localhost","root","","ukk");

// Check connection

if (mysqli_connect_errno()){

echo "Koneksi database gagal : " . mysqli_connect_error();

?>


Selanjutnya kita membuat halaman untul form registrasi admin

registrasi.php


Untuk css dari registrasi kita samakan dengan login.

Dan hasilnya adalah:


Cek_reg.php

<?php 

// koneksi database

include 'koneksi.php';


// menangkap data yang di kirim dari form

$nama = $_POST['nama'];

$username = $_POST['username'];

$password = $_POST['password'];

$telp = $_POST['telp'];

$level = $_POST['level'];


// menginput data ke database

mysqli_query($koneksi,"insert into mahasiswa values('','$nama','$username','$password', '$telp', 'level')");


// mengalihkan halaman kembali ke index.php

header("location:login.php");


?>

sekian dari saya tunggu part selanjutnya

0 Komentar